Output dd208b08269382032eade85fbc045228e53ecacce8f89416bbb1682c563bab73:0

value
99497180
script pubkey
OP_0 OP_PUSHBYTES_20 89aac10b7b32896e036acb24c408f109c2121202
address
bc1q3x4vzzmmx2ykuqm2evjvgz83p8ppyysz74y4et
transaction
dd208b08269382032eade85fbc045228e53ecacce8f89416bbb1682c563bab73
confirmations
1451
spent
true